Wire Ends
« on: July 30, 2011, 04:26:28 PM »
Im looking for female headers that can go on end of a wire. So that i can connect them to the pins on the Axon/ Does any one know where i can get some and if possible supply a part number thanks.

The item you're probably looking for is a "crimp pin", which will require some crimpers to go with it (or you could just solder it, but it's much slower and doesn't work quite as well).

Pololu has a selection of various kinds: http://www.pololu.com/catalog/category/19 if you scroll down the page you'll see they have JST/JR etc. type connectors.

They also sell a crimper tool. Admin doesn't like it, but mine works ok for the $34 I paid for it. Since using a professional one here at work I understand his viewpoint better, but for the money I'm happy with it.
